
The drive from Samara to Quepos to Puerto Jemeniz
Driving in Costa Rica can be quite stressful. The roads are very narrow and winding. There are a lot of trucks that travel the roads and they tend to hold up traffic. The speed limits vary from 40 kph to the rare 80 kph and there are not any alternate routes to take so if you get stuff behind someone slow, you’re there for a while until you make a risky passing move. We ran into holiday traffic leaving Samara ( pronounced like camera with an S) so it took us 6 hours to reach Quepos. I was quite exhausted once we rolled into town .

The drive from Quepos to The Osa Peninsula is absolutely breathtaking. You drive along the coast, then up into the mountains then finally ascending into the coast again. There was some treacherous washouts but after around 4 hours we made it to our hotel the Agua Dolce. The same place I stayed 3 years ago.
It’s difficult to get to as it’s a long dirt road that’s not in very good shape but the great thing about it is that you pretty much have the whole beach to yourselves.
